Car: 1995 sc400

Full Mod list:

EXTERIOR:
-Black with a small amount of gold flake
-Painted within the last few years
-OEM 97+ Front bumper
-OEM 97+ Side skirts
-OEM 97+ Rear bumper
-Home depot front lip
-Tinted Roof Spoiler
-Shaved emblems
-8000k hid's
-9x led license plate lights
-Front fenders rolled/pulled
-Rear fenders rolled/pulled 1.5"

INTERIOR:
-Black/leather
-Woodgrain wrapped in neffy carbon wrap
-TT MK4 Supra seats freshly redone, drivers seat electric
-New OEM Drivers window motor/regulator
-New OEM Passenger window motor/regulator
-Led dome light

ENGINE:
-1JZGTE
-Freshly rebuilt head - all new seals, lapped valves, pvc valve, gaskets
-2jzgte headgasket
-Driftmotion 60-1 Single turbo kit .70ar
-Thermal intake manifold gasket
-3" v-band downpipe
-Ceramic coated exhaust housing
-Titanium Turbo blanket
-Front mount intercooler
-3" polished charge piping w/t-bolt clamps
-Tial Q BOV
-Turbo XS manual boost controller
-3" Turbo back exhaust w/ Apexi muffler anodized black
-Innovate LC-1 wideband
-Defi boost gauge
-Mapecu3
-JDM 440cc injectors
-Aluminum radiator
-Dual electric fans on relays
-New 100amp alternator
-working p/s AND a/c

TRANSMISSION:
-A340LE Auto
-Shimmed 1-2 accumulator
-Shimmed 2-3 accumulator
-Line pressure increased internally
-Trans cooler

WHEELS:
-TT MK4 Supra wheels satin black
-245/45 front tires
-275/45 rear tires
-50mm wheel studs
-10mm spacers front
-15mm spacers rear
-Muteki neo-chrome extended lugs

SUSPENSION:
-Powered by Max full coilovers 9way adjustable damper 12k F 16K R springs

BRAKES:
-LS400 BBK - drilled and slotted rotors w/ stainless lines
-Drilled slotted rears w/ stainless lines
-Hawk Pads
